Least Common Multiple of 30335 and 30348 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 30335 and 30348,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(30335,30348) = 1
LCM(30335,30348) = ( 30335 × 30348) / 1
LCM(30335,30348) = 920606580 / 1
LCM(30335,30348) = 920606580
